Ensuring Robot Safety with Positron’s Three-Tiered Approach
The Positron platform isn’t a single solution, but a comprehensive system built around three core components. First, there’s the certifiable safety hardware – available in STA1 (Arm), STI1 (Intel), and STN1 (Nvidia) variants – offering specialized compute modules and carrier boards. This hardware forms the foundation of a robust safety architecture. Second, the Positron SDK provides the software tools necessary for developing safety-critical applications, including advanced kinematics and reliable safe human detection. Finally, and crucially, Synapticon offers support for integrating the entire safety system into a robot and achieving application-specific certification – a process often fraught with complexity.
At the heart of the system is “The Guardian AI,” a control mechanism designed to anticipate and redirect potentially dangerous robot actions. This isn’t about stopping robots; it’s about ensuring they operate safely within their environment. Synapticon is also strategically aligning Positron with upcoming industry standards, notably ISO 25785, demonstrating a commitment to long-term compliance and interoperability.
Beyond Safety: Actilink-S and the Next Generation of Actuators
But Synapticon’s innovation doesn’t stop at safety. Alongside Positron, the company is showcasing the Actilink-S product family – a game-changer in servo motor technology. These aren’t your typical motors; they integrate servo motors, sensors, drive electronics, and motion control into a single, compact device. Imagine the simplification of robot assembly and commissioning! Actilink-S motors are delivered fully assembled and configured using OblacDrive Tools software, with options for EtherCAT, PROFINET, and EtherNet/IP fieldbus communication.
For demanding applications, particularly in humanoid robotics, Synapticon is previewing the Actilink-JD DUO series. These Quasi Direct Drives, featuring two-stage planetary gears, are designed for highly stressed joints. The planned variants boast impressive specifications: 24-48V (60V peak) operation, 320-1,000 watts of output power, 20-85 Nm nominal torque (potentially up to 320 Nm peak). The low-backlash planetary gearbox and high-torque motors promise both dynamic performance and unwavering reliability, even under extreme mechanical loads. And, remarkably, they retain superior reverse drive capability compared to conventional actuators.
